Edit -- Just for the record I thought Maniscalco was more deserving of FOY than Stinnett, but Stinnett is a good player and will be a tough matchup for us in the future.
 
The real travesty is Stinnett getting NOY over Theron Wilson. I can hardly believe that. I hope this lights a fire under TW for Friday's game. BU certainly should not be lacking any motivation whatsoever.
 
Theron Wilson ....12.6 ppg, 6.1 rpg, 51.4% 3-pt shooting, 46% FG shooting, 1.5 spg,
P'Allen Stinnett....13.2ppg, 3.8 rpg, 30.4% 3-pt shooting, 44.7% FG shooting, 1.5 spg,

I am biased, but Theron's rebounds and shooting pct. give him some real consideration.
Had Theron taken a whole lot more shots as PAS did (which is why his scoring avg. was higher), his scoring avg. would have been several points higher.
